Transcription is the first step in the protein synthesis process. Translation is the second.

Overall, the central dogma of biology is DNA->RNA->protein.

Transcription is that first step, DNA to RNA, and translation is RNA to protein: think of it like nucleic acids can just be transcribed, but nucleic acid to protein is like a whole different language, so it has to be translated. So the correct answer here is that mRNA is used to make amino acid chain (aka protein), which happens only in translation.

Tundra is above the tree line.  While a few trees that can be found there such as willow or birch, it is known for it's lack of trees and extreme cold.

Taiga has short, wet and warm summers, and long,  very cold winters. This biome is also known as Boreal Forest. You will find coniferous forests with evergreen trees such as pine, fir, spruce. An example is the Siberian Forest.

What are cations?

A cation has more protons than electrons, consequently giving it a net positive charge. For a cation to form, one or more electrons must be lost, typically pulled away by atoms with a stronger affinity for them.

The number of electrons lost, and so the charge of the ion, is indicated after the chemical symbol, e.g. silver (Ag) loses one electron to become Ag+, whilst zinc (Zn) loses two electrons to become Zn2+.

In contrast, most nonmetallic atoms have a stronger attraction to electrons than do metallic atoms, and as a result, they gain electrons to form anions.

An allele is a variant form of a gene. Some genes have a variety of different forms, which are located at the same position, or genetic locus, on a chromosome. Humans are called diploid organisms because they have two alleles at each genetic locus, with one allele inherited from each parent.

This is a question having to do with tonicity, or the concentrations of solutes or solvents across a membrane.  In these conditions, there is a hypotonic solution inside the cell (hypo means low, because there's less water inside), which will cause water to come inside.

The contractile vacuole stops the cell from exploding by regulating the amount of water that can come in. Otherwise, it would lyse, or split open.
